Ioannidou Iliana MD, MSc is a Pulmonologist - Phthisiologist - Acupuncturist and maintains a private practice in Ilioupoli. She graduated from the Medical School of the University of Crete and holds a postgraduate degree in "Lung Cancer: Modern Clinical and Laboratory Approach & Research" from the Medical School of the National and Kapodistrian University of Athens. She began her specialty in Pulmonology - Phthisiology at the Lung Cancer Center of the Academic Hospital Clemenshospital in Münster, Germany, and completed it at the General Hospital for Chest Diseases of Athens "Sotiria." She specialized in Intensive Care at the University Intensive Care Unit of the General Hospital for Chest Diseases of Athens "Sotiria," where she served as an Attending Physician for 2 years. Concurrently, the doctor has been trained in Medical Acupuncture at the International Postgraduate Acupuncture Center AcuScience, under the auspices of the Hellenic Medical Acupuncture Society, as well as in Advanced and Immediate Life Support (ALS & ILS provider). She served as an Attending Physician in the Intensive Care Unit of the Athens Medical Center, while to date she remains an Attending Physician of the Pulmonology Team at the same hospital. In her private practice, she offers a wide range of services, personalized to the specific needs of each patient.
